Transaction 3576d931160250bbe0d63f9a354572f37ecf29f4415a7228ac36073dab529f6a

2 Input
2 Outputs
  • 3576d931160250bbe0d63f9a354572f37ecf29f4415a7228ac36073dab529f6a:0
  • value  38855513
    address  3FUBWpZsbGFmXJKWFzouEWneTmmrhaLQRH
  • 3576d931160250bbe0d63f9a354572f37ecf29f4415a7228ac36073dab529f6a:1
  • value  11616695
    address  3KMLD5pxApAuF4ZBkELQpAip6gXtSa1K6c